Как складывать строки в Python: легкое руководство с примерами
В Python есть несколько способов складывать строки:
1. С помощью оператора +
string1 = "Привет, "
string2 = "мир!"
result = string1 + string2
print(result) # Выводит: Привет, мир!
2. С помощью метода join()
string1 = "Привет, "
string2 = "мир!"
result = ''.join([string1, string2])
print(result) # Выводит: Привет, мир!
3. С помощью форматирования строк
string1 = "Привет"
string2 = "мир"
result = "{}, {}!".format(string1, string2)
print(result) # Выводит: Привет, мир!
Выберите удобный вариант и складывайте строки в Python!
Детальный ответ
Как складывать строки в Python
В программировании, складывание строк – это процесс объединения двух или более строк в одну. В Python, существует несколько способов складывать строки, включая использование оператора "+", метода "join()" и форматирования строк. Давайте рассмотрим каждый способ подробнее.
1. Использование оператора "+":
Один из наиболее распространенных способов складывания строк в Python – это использование оператора "+". Просто указываем строки, которые нужно объединить, и разделяем их оператором "+". Ниже приведен пример:
str1 = "Привет, "
str2 = "Мир!"
result = str1 + str2
print(result)
В этом примере мы создаем две переменные – "str1" и "str2", содержащие строки "Привет, " и "Мир!" соответственно. Затем мы складываем их с помощью оператора "+", и результат выводится на экран:
Привет, Мир!
2. Использование метода "join()":
Еще один способ складывания строк в Python – это использование метода "join()". Метод "join()" принимает список строк в качестве аргумента и возвращает новую строку, объединяя все элементы списка. Вот пример его использования:
str_list = ["Привет", " ", "Мир!"]
result = "".join(str_list)
print(result)
В этом примере у нас есть список строк "str_list", содержащий элементы "Привет", " " и "Мир!". Мы используем метод "join()" с пустой строкой в качестве разделителя, чтобы объединить все элементы списка в одну строку. Результат выводится на экран:
Привет Мир!
3. Использование форматирования строк:
Третий способ складывания строк в Python – это использование форматирования строк. Форматирование строк позволяет объединить строки и вставить значения переменных в определенные места. Пример использования форматирования строк:
name = "Иван"
age = 25
result = "Меня зовут {}. Мне {} лет.".format(name, age)
print(result)
В этом примере мы используем фигурные скобки {} внутри строки и метод "format()" для вставки значений переменных "name" и "age" в соответствующие места. Результат выводится на экран:
Меня зовут Иван. Мне 25 лет.
Заключение:
В данной статье мы рассмотрели три способа складывания строк в Python: использование оператора "+", метода "join()" и форматирования строк. Они могут быть использованы в зависимости от ваших конкретных потребностей. При выборе метода обратите внимание на удобство использования, читаемость кода и производительность. Надеюсь, эта статья помогла вам лучше понять, как складывать строки в Python!